The Changing Landscape of Slot Gaming
Historically, slot machines trace their origins to land-based casinos where mechanical reels and minimal features defined player experiences. However, the advent of digital technology has reshaped this space profoundly. Today, online slots are no longer mere digital replicas but sophisticated products featuring high-quality graphics, comprehensive sound design, and integrated bonus mechanics. Data from the European Casino Association indicates that online slot revenue in Europe alone surpassed €8 billion in 2022, underscoring their dominant market position.
Recent innovations focus heavily on thematic storytelling and gameplay diversification, aligning with broader trends that emphasise player retention and emotional engagement. Industry leader NetEnt, for instance, routinely launches slots that blend pop culture references with advanced mechanics, setting benchmarks for entertainment value and innovation.

Innovative Mechanics and Unique Gameplay Features
| Feature | Description |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Expanding Reels | Reel structures that grow or change during gameplay, e.g., Megaways™ technology | Increases potential winning combinations, enhances unpredictability |
| Multi-Level Gaming | Progression through different game phases or stories within one session | Prolongs engagement and introduces strategic elements |
| Interactive Bonus Games | Mini-games activated through specific in-game symbols or actions | Transforms slot gameplay into engaging, game-like experiences |
| Gamified Mechanics | Player challenges and achievement systems integrated into the game | Encourages repeat play and loyalty |
These mechanics reflect a deliberate move away from traditional, static gameplay toward dynamic, player-centric experiences. Industry pioneers integrating such features report increased player retention rates, with some titles surpassing 30% in session longevity.

The Role of Player Trust and Fairness
As innovation progresses, maintaining player trust remains paramount. Journals like The European Gaming & Betting Association highlight that transparency concerning randomness and payout fairness boosts player confidence, which is vital for sustained growth. Reputable developers utilise certified Random Number Generators (RNGs) and openly publish Return to Player (RTP) percentages.
For example, certain innovative slots are celebrated within the industry for their transparency and high RTPs, often exceeding 96%. This high standard provides players with both entertainment and confidence in the game mechanics.
